What is Eastern Research Group (ERG) and what do they do?

Eastern Research Group (ERG) is an environmental consulting firm that provides research, technical, and analytical services to government agencies, private companies, and nonprofits. Their expertise covers areas such as environmental science, engineering, public health, data analysis, and communication. ERG assists clients with tasks like regulatory compliance, policy analysis, program evaluation, and environmental impact assessments. Their work supports informed decision-making and helps address complex environmental and health challenges.

What types of projects do consultants at Eastern Research Group typically work on, and how do these projects support professional development?

Consultants at Eastern Research Group (ERG) often work on multidisciplinary projects involving environmental consulting, public health analysis, and technical support for government and private-sector clients. These projects range from data analysis and modeling to regulatory compliance and policy assessment. Working on diverse teams, consultants gain exposure to various subject matter experts and methodologies, fostering skill development and career growth. The collaborative project structure at ERG enables team members to take on increasing levels of responsibility, which supports advancement within the organ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Environmental Consultant at Eastern Research Group,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Environmental Consultant at Eastern Research Group, you typically need a background in environmental science, engineering, or a related field, supported by relevant degrees or certifications. Familiarity with environmental modeling software, data analysis tools, and regulatory compliance systems is essential. Strong analytical thinking, clear communication, and project management skills help consultants effectively collaborate with clients and stakeholders. These competencies are vital to delivering accurate environmental solutions, meeting regulatory requirements, and ensuring project success.
